だから私はと呼ばれるテーブルを持っていますRonde
:
ID | Teamid | Timestamp
----------------------------------------
1 | 1 | 2013-06-28 18:35:28
2 | 1 | 2013-06-28 18:36:28
3 | 2 | 2013-06-28 18:36:30
4 | 3 | 2013-06-28 18:37:28
5 | 2 | 2013-06-28 18:40:28
6 | 1 | 2013-06-28 18:42:28
7 | 2 | 2013-06-28 18:43:28
8 | 3 | 2013-06-28 18:48:28
だから私が必要とするのは、グループ化された2つの最新のレコードを取得しTeamid
、 で数学関数を実行するクエリですtimestamp
。
例:
newest1, newest2
result = ( 60 minutes / (newest2.timestamp - newest1.timestamp) ) * 6
結果は、2 つのタイムスタンプ間の平均速度です。
`LIMIT` in subquery don't work
誰かが私の問題の解決策を持っていますか???
希望する出力データ:
チームID | スピード 1 | 60 2 | 120 3 | 32,72